Bella Casa Fashion & Retail Limited (NSE:BELLACASA)
India flag India · Delayed Price · Currency is INR
400.05
+1.50 (0.38%)
At close: Sep 26, 2025

NSE:BELLACASA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Sep '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
5,3564,6613,4451,3441,9911,502
Upgrade
Market Cap Growth
-14.77%35.27%156.30%-32.50%32.58%27.09%
Upgrade
Enterprise Value
5,5085,4333,8641,7822,4321,812
Upgrade
PE Ratio
31.2129.5133.8417.3217.8427.81
Upgrade
PS Ratio
1.471.341.500.670.971.17
Upgrade
PB Ratio
3.583.124.061.782.862.51
Upgrade
P/TBV Ratio
3.593.124.061.782.862.51
Upgrade
P/FCF Ratio
-330.51527.2210.07-48.81
Upgrade
P/OCF Ratio
-39.3595.018.80-26.41
Upgrade
EV/Sales Ratio
1.511.561.680.881.181.41
Upgrade
EV/EBITDA Ratio
18.5319.7020.8111.7011.7016.32
Upgrade
EV/EBIT Ratio
20.8521.1122.6012.8212.4618.02
Upgrade
EV/FCF Ratio
-385.28591.2613.35-58.88
Upgrade
Debt / Equity Ratio
0.210.210.510.520.830.81
Upgrade
Debt / EBITDA Ratio
1.051.092.292.512.744.35
Upgrade
Debt / FCF Ratio
-22.1166.472.95-15.82
Upgrade
Asset Turnover
-1.861.511.321.310.94
Upgrade
Inventory Turnover
-2.912.052.022.171.59
Upgrade
Quick Ratio
-1.300.530.580.610.58
Upgrade
Current Ratio
-3.351.911.981.711.66
Upgrade
Return on Equity (ROE)
-13.48%12.69%10.69%17.22%9.39%
Upgrade
Return on Assets (ROA)
-8.60%7.01%5.67%7.76%4.58%
Upgrade
Return on Capital (ROIC)
10.69%10.41%8.79%7.16%10.32%6.05%
Upgrade
Return on Capital Employed (ROCE)
-15.80%19.70%17.40%25.10%14.20%
Upgrade
Earnings Yield
3.20%3.39%2.96%5.77%5.61%3.60%
Upgrade
FCF Yield
-0.30%0.19%9.93%-2.60%2.05%
Upgrade
Payout Ratio
-7.05%9.02%23.81%13.88%12.75%
Upgrade
Buyback Yield / Dilution
-15.16%-11.09%----
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.